Eco-friendly Crafting Materials
Amid rising environmental awareness, sustainable materials have taken center stage in the crafting world. Crafters are now gravitating towards recycled paper, organic dyes, and biodegradable accessories. Brands are responding to this demand by offering ethically sourced materials that promise to reduce environmental footprints. Using materials like hemp paper and mushroom leather provides an array of textures while ensuring a commitment to the environment. Renewed interest in nature-based themes also encourages using botanically inspired prints and natural dyes. This trend not only appeals to eco-conscious crafters but enhances the authenticity of handmade pieces.

Cultural Inspiration and Fusion
2025 will see paper crafters drawing inspiration from a rich tapestry of global cultures. This fusion approach ensures that crafting remains an inclusive and diverse hobby. Traditional patterns from Asia, Africa, and Latin America are finding renewed interest, with crafters incorporating elements like Batik prints, Aztec motifs, and Japanese washi. Festivals, folklore, and indigenous stories are reflected in craft creations, allowing for an authentic exploration of different cultures. This movement towards fusion crafting celebrates diversity and offers countless ways to express individual artistic voices.

Minimalist and Geometric Designs
Opting for simplicity and sophistication, minimalism in paper crafts will be a significant trend in 2025. Crafters are exploring clean lines and geometric shapes, reflecting a movement towards understated elegance. Such designs often use neutral palettes and emphasize form over embellishment, resonating with those seeking calm and order. Modular origami, which involves connecting several single units into a larger structure, highlights this minimalist approach. These creations, with their disciplined and purposeful design, are expected to continue gaining popularity in both home decor and functional arts.

Artfully Layered Mixed Media
The rise of mixed media in paper crafting introduces a multi-dimensional aspect to traditional methods, blending paper with textiles, metals, and paints. This trend provides an avenue for innovation, encouraging crafters to experiment with textures and forms. Techniques such as paper quilling combined with embroidery and metallic foil accents create captivating contrasts and depth. Adding cut-outs or interwoven elements can convert simple projects into elaborate masterpieces, offering endless creative possibilities. Layered mixed media designs invite crafters to push the boundaries of what's possible in paper arts.

Digital Augmentation and DIY Kits
While paper crafting is inherently hands-on, digital enhancement is transforming the craft landscape. High-tech cutting machines and augmented reality applications now assist crafters in bringing their visions to life with precision. Additionally, DIY kits are gaining traction, as they offer curated supplies and step-by-step instructions for seamlessly combining analog and digital techniques. These innovations aim to bridge gaps in skill levels, enabling beginners and experienced crafters alike to elevate their creations. Enhanced accessibility through digital tools ensures that the crafting community continues to thrive.

Functional and Stylish Stationery
Paper crafting extends into functional art with the resurgence of personalized stationery, diaries, and planners. Crafters are designing bespoke stationery products adorned with watercolor splashes, embossed lettering, and custom seals. This trend combines functionality with artistic aesthetics, providing a platform for the proliferation of handcrafted stationery. With individuals seeking to add personal touches to both personal correspondence and workspace essentials, the demand for crafted stationery that expresses individual style continues to rise.

Interactive Paper Sculptures
The art of paper sculpture takes on a new dimension in 2025, focusing on interactive elements and kinetic design. These sculptures often include moving parts or elements that invite viewer engagement, bridging the gap between viewer and creator. Interactive pop-up books, animated scenes, and transformer-like models showcase craftsmanship and delightful surprises. This trend emphasizes a playful interaction, catering to all ages and turning paper sculptures into captivating centerpieces or conversation starters. By integrating motion and interactivity, these creations breathe life into the paper craft world.
